How much do assistant building supervisor j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average yearly pay for assistant building supervisor in Kent, WA is $62,816.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$45,200.00 and $72,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an assistant building supervisor do?

An Assistant Building Supervisor helps oversee the daily operations and maintenance of a building or facility. They assist the Building Supervisor in managing staff, ensuring safety protocols are followed, coordinating repairs, and maintaining the cleanliness and functionality of the premises. Their duties may also include conducting inspections, handling minor administrative tasks, and responding to tenant or occupant concerns. This role is essential for keeping the building running smoothly and addressing issues promptly.

What skills and qualifications are needed to be an assistant building supervisor?

To thrive as an Assistant Building Supervisor, you need knowledge of building maintenance, facility operations, and safety regulations,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ent and relevant experience. Familiarity with building management systems (BMS), maintenance scheduling software, and compliance protocols is typically required. Strong organizational skills,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ication help in coordinating teams and addressing tenant concerns. These competencies are essential for ensuring smooth facility operations, safety, and a positive environment for occupants.

How does an assistant building supervisor typically collaborate with maintenance and security teams?

An Assistant Building Supervisor works closely with both maintenance and security personnel to ensure the building operates smoothly and safely. They often coordinate routine inspections, prioritize repair requests, and communicate any facility issues to the appropriate team. Maintaining open lines of communication and organizing regular meetings helps address concerns promptly and supports a safe and well-maintained environment. This collaborative approach is essential for preventing disruptions and ensuring tenant satisfaction.

What is the difference between Assistant Building Supervisor vs Building Supervisor?

AspectAssistant Building SupervisorBuilding Supervisor
CertificationsOSHA safety training, basic building management certificationsOSHA safety training, advanced building management certifications
Work EnvironmentAssists in daily building operations, supports maintenance teamsOversees entire building operations, manages staff and vendors
ResponsibilitiesSupports supervisors, handles routine tasks, responds to tenant requestsManages building staff, enforces safety protocols, coordinates repairs

The main difference between an Assistant Building Supervisor and a Building Supervisor lies in their scope of responsibilities. The Assistant supports the supervisor with daily tasks and routine operations, while the Building Supervisor oversees all building functions, staff, and safety protocols. Both roles require similar certifications, but the supervisor position involves more leadership and decision-making duties.

Center Art LLC, managed by the Space Needle LLC, is partnering with Chihuly Studio to operate the Chihuly Garden and Glass Exhibition on the Seattle Center grounds next to the Space Needle.


GENERAL POSITION SUMMARY:

The Custodial Supervisor supports Center Art’s mission, vision and values by exhibiting the following behaviors: excellence, competence, collaboration, innovation, respect, personalization, accountability and ownership.

The Custodial Supervisor is responsible for maintaining a clean, safe, and welcoming environment across all operational spaces, including two Seattle Center campus attractions and HUB administrative offices. This role supervises custodial functions while ensuring all guest-facing, team-facing, and back-of-house areas meet the highest standards of presentation, safety, and care. The position requires adaptability within a Flex Service model and a strong commitment to both guest and team member experiences.


PRIMARY FUNCTIONS:

  • Support and instill a genuine desire to create a clean, safe, and positive environment for all guests and team members.
  • Promote safety and security while maintaining a welcoming and professional atmosphere.
  • Supervise and support custodial team members in daily operations, ensuring all responsibilities are executed efficiently and to standard.
  • Ensure all areas of the operation remain at peak levels of cleanliness, sanitation, and presentation while protecting the brand and artwork.
  • Oversee and perform custodial duties including restroom sanitation, trash removal, dusting, floor care (vacuuming, mopping, buffing, polishing), window cleaning, and supply stocking.
  • Execute theater and high-volume cleaning tasks such as preshow preparation, show-turn cleaning, and operational resets.
  • Maintain cleanliness in guest areas including lobbies, retail spaces, food and beverage locations, and plaza dining areas.
  • Ensure consistent execution of daily, weekly, and monthly cleaning routines and opening/closing procedures.
  • Maintain accountability with team members to ensure proper use of custodial equipment, adherence to procedures, and completion of assigned duties.
  • Act as a safety leader by identifying and addressing hazards (“see something, say something”).
  • Ensure compliance with sanitation standards, SDS requirements, and chemical handling procedures.
  • Maintain clean and organized custodial closets, equipment rooms, and storage areas using 5S practices.
  • Monitor and maintain exterior grounds, pathways, and garden areas to ensure they are clean and debris-free.
  • Report maintenance issues, safety concerns, pest activity, and any risks to artwork or facilities.
  • Assist in training, coaching, and development of custodial team members.
  • Communicate effectively with managers, supervisors, team members, and cross-functional departments.
  • Flex across multiple campus locations and adapt to changing operational needs.
  • Maintain knowledge of all operational procedures, policies, and facility information.
  • Participate in leadership meetings and contribute to continuous improvement efforts.
  • Respond to guest inquiries and provide information about the exhibition and surrounding area.
  • Any other responsibilities as defined by management.
